Lesson 2: What are the types of scams? The Trading Trouble/Sending Sourness Scams

I am assuming you have seen me saying, for example, so-and-so was found doing the: blah blah blah scam. Are you confused? Well, you won't be. This lesson is about two types of scams that go under the same lines. They are the Trading Trouble and the Sending Sourness Scams.

Let's start with the Trading Trouble scam. This scam is pretty popular these days. The scammer usually has a store-bought item on trade, a non member necklace is very common. He will be saying something like this: "Hey, People! If you trade me a fox hat, I will give you my outfit!" or, "Trade me a worn and you get ten betas!" You know, something like that.

Ok, lets pretend that didn't happen. Instead of trading, I recommend asking him questions so you have a full on idea if he is a scammer or not. So you ask him, "Why can't I just trade my Beta mat for your Party Hat?" 
He may answer with, "Well, that won't work." or, "Uh, if you trade for the necklace, it'll separate the good trades from the bad trades."

Ok, for one thing, if it takes a while for them to answer, its most likely a scam. They are probably thinking of what to say. I am not a scammer, don't think I am giving you tips.

Anyway, back to the lesson. Basically, that is the Trading Trouble Scam.

Now, we will talk about the Sending Sourness Scam. Since non-members cannot send gifts, your safe! Yay!!! But members, really, watch out for this scam.
You see a jammer saying, "Send me a beta flooring and I will send you -place rare here-!!!!"         So you decide to. You send your sweets wallpaper. And guess what happens? He just simply logs out and takes your sweets wallpaper!!! See? It's roughly exactly like the Trading Trouble Scam.
